Output 90e03c247ceed100cd6d29c7b88c754fc4f948808c7a963192e508d11b2a7a09:7

value
359851
script pubkey
OP_0 OP_PUSHBYTES_20 ae50fdfc1bbd6c72033c2469163fbc333e672804
address
bc1q4eg0mlqmh4k8yqeuy353v0auxvlxw2qyt3ajqf
transaction
90e03c247ceed100cd6d29c7b88c754fc4f948808c7a963192e508d11b2a7a09
confirmations
44477
spent
true